Diagnosing Tesla Front Trunk Issues: Sensor & Switch Tests

Diagnosing Tesla front trunk issues, particularly those related to sensors or switches, is a critical step in any repair process. This involves a meticulous approach that combines advanced diagnostic tools with hands-on automotive collision repair expertise. Start by inspecting the exterior for any signs of damage to the bumper and surrounding bodywork—a key indicator of potential sensor malfunction.

Sensor and switch tests are essential components of Tesla front trunk repair. Utilize specialized equipment, such as multimetres, to check for power and ground connections, voltage drops, and signal integrity. For instance, a faulty trunk release sensor might exhibit intermittent power fluctuations or a complete loss of signal. Analyzing these data points helps in pinpointing the exact problem area.

Consider the vehicle’s bodywork as an interconnected system. A bump or dent near the front trunk could impact nearby sensors or switches, leading to inaccurate readings or failure. Professional mechanics often employ advanced diagnostic techniques, like computer-aided scanning and sensor simulations, to isolate the problematic component. Step-by-Step Guide: Replacing Faulty Sensors or Switches

Begin by locating the specific sensor or switch in need of replacement. Accessing the front trunk involves opening the trunk from the interior and removing any necessary panels to expose the components hidden beneath. Once visible, inspect the sensor or switch for signs of damage, corrosion, or loose connections. Common issues include short circuits due to water intrusion, wear and tear over time, or accidental damage.

The repair process commences with safety precautions. Ensure your vehicle is parked on a level surface, apply the parking brake, and disconnect the battery to prevent any electrical shocks during work. Using specialized tools designed for automotive body work, carefully disassemble the affected area, taking note of intricate wiring harnesses and other components. This meticulous approach minimizes the risk of damaging surrounding areas or causing short circuits.

After removing the faulty sensor or switch, acquire a replacement part that’s a perfect match for your Tesla model. Install the new component, securing it tightly with the appropriate hardware. Reconnect the wiring harness, ensuring each connection is secure and properly aligned. Before closing out the repair, double-check all connections and test the functionality of the replaced sensor or switch to confirm its optimal performance.
